The Issue

In the heart of our Pewsham, Chippenham community stands a beacon of hope and support—Barnado's charity shop. For years, this shop has served not just as a retail outlet, but as a lifeline for many children who depend on the resources and assistance that its charitable efforts provide. Sadly, due to the rising tide of inflation and increased rent costs, this vital lifeline is under threat. Unless we take immediate action, Barnado's will be forced to close its doors come May 2nd 2026.

The closure of Barnado's in Pewsham would not only result in the loss of a cherished community hub, but it would also cut off a significant source of support for vulnerable children who rely on their services. This isn't just a local issue; it reflects the broader challenges faced by charitable organizations across the country who are feeling the squeeze of financial pressure.

Barnado's has been tirelessly working to better the lives of countless young people throughout the UK. The shop in Pewsham has been instrumental in funding projects, offering clothing, toys, and necessities that make a direct impact on children who are most in need. Beyond being a shop, it’s a place where the community comes together, finds affordable goods, and directly supports a worthy cause.
